As men age, particularly over the age of 40, they may start to experience changes in their urinary comfort and overall wellness. This is often due to a combination of hormonal changes, lifestyle factors, and the natural aging process. Fortunately, there are several natural approaches that men can adopt to support urinary health and enhance daily well-being.
One of the most effective ways to promote urinary comfort is through proper hydration. Drinking sufficient amounts of water daily is crucial, as dehydration can lead to concentrated urine, which may irritate the bladder. Aim for at least eight glasses of water a day, and consider moderating your intake of caffeine and alcohol, as these can act as diuretics and potentially worsen urinary issues.
In addition to hydration, diet plays a vital role in urinary health. Consuming a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and healthy fats can provide the necessary nutrients to support overall wellness. Foods such as berries, apples, and citrus fruits are not only hydrating but also packed with antioxidants that help reduce inflammation. Additionally, incorporating pumpkin seeds, which are naturally high in zinc, can support prostate health. The omega-3 fatty acids found in fish like salmon can also contribute to a reduction in inflammation.
Regular physical activity is another essential component of maintaining urinary comfort and overall wellness. Exercise improves blood circulation, aids in weight management, and enhances metabolic functions, all of which can positively impact urinary health. Aim to engage in at least 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ity each week, which can include walking, swimming, or cycling. Strength training exercises twice a week can also be beneficial, especially for maintaining healthy muscle mass.
Men over 40 should also consider integrating pelvic floor exercises into their routine. Known as Kegel exercises, these can strengthen the pelvic floor muscles, improve bladder control, and enhance sexual health. To perform Kegel exercises, identify the muscles used to stop urination, tighten them for a few seconds, and then release. Repeat this process several times a day for optimal results.
Stress management is crucial when it comes to supporting urinary comfort and overall health. Elevated stress levels can lead to various physical issues, including bladder problems. Finding effective ways to manage stress, such as through meditation, yoga, or deep-breathing exercises, can greatly enhance daily wellness. Engaging in hobbies, spending time with loved ones, or even allocating time for nature walks can also help reduce stress and foster a sense of well-being.
Quality sleep is deeply interconnected with overall health and can significantly influence urinary comfort. Men over 40 should ensure they are getting sufficient restorative sleep each night. Establishing a consistent sleep schedule, creating a comfortable sleep environment, and practicing good sleep hygiene can all encourage better sleep quality.
Additionally, consider the benefits of natural supplements to further support urinary health. Saw palmetto and pygeum are two herbal supplements commonly associated with prostate health. Coupled with a healthy lifestyle, these supplements may provide additional support and comfort. However, it is crucial to consult with a healthcare provider before starting any new supplement regimen to ensure they are appropriate for your individual health needs.
